Things to do in Kansas City

There are plenty of fun activities in Kansas City. The Plaza is a fifteen-block-long shopping and dining hub. This outdoor mall features European architecture and more that 30 statues. You can find the perfect souvenir here or visit an art museum.

Worlds of Fun amusement parks

Worlds of Fun, Kansas City's largest park, is the home to one of the city's most popular attractions. It's located on 235 acres, with rides for all ages, thrill rides and water slides. From April to November, the park is open. The park is accessible to those with disabilities. The front gate offers wheelchair rentals.

Worlds of Fun offers several ticket package options that include price discounts, fun opportunities, customizable admission, and customized admission. A 3-day advance ticket is $10 cheaper than the usual price. Single-day junior/senior tickets, for children under 48 inches tall, and Dinosaurs Alive admission are also available. Twilight admission, which is only available on weekends, reduces admission for guests who arrive after 4:00 p.m.

The amusement park was opened in 1973. It has continued to expand. Worlds of Fun is the Midwest's largest water park. Oceans of Fun, which is adjacent to Worlds of Fun, is included in your admission to Worlds of Fun. Many family-friendly rides are also available.

Worlds of Fun is a great family-friendly amusement parks in Kansas City. The park is accessible for wheelchair users and offers free entry to pre-schoolers. Worlds of Fun can also be a great place for groups or organizations. Worlds of Fun is a fantastic place to visit if you're looking for a fun day out with the family or an affordable way to make lasting memories.

Worlds of Fun has a variety of water rides, rollercoasters and mini golf. You will also find a great arcade with over 60 games.

American Jazz Museum

The American Jazz Museum is Kansas City's jazz museum that focuses on the history and music of American jazz. It has exhibits that include musicians such as Duke Ellington or Louis Armstrong, Ella Fitzgerald or Charlie Parker. The museum's aim is to make American jazz history more accessible.

The American Jazz Museum can be found in the historic 18th and Vine Jazz district. It offers interactive exhibits, films and a changing gallery. A 500-seat performing art center hosts live performances. Federal holidays are not allowed to be held at the museum. The Blue Room hosts weekly jam sessions. The Blue Room also hosts a Latin Jazz/Salsa series monthly.

Kansas City's American Jazz Museum offers a unique experience for jazz enthusiasts and history buffs alike. It showcases the history of African American musicians and restaurateurs in the city’s music scene. It promotes jazz education as well as research. The American Jazz Museum of Kansas City is dedicated to celebrating the music and contributions of African Americans to American culture.

This Kansas City jazz museum honors American jazz history with interactive exhibits, educational programmes, and a live jazz band. The museum is located at the 18th and Vine Historic Jazz District and focuses on the cultural and musical boom that took place during the 1920s and 2030s in Kansas City. The Smithsonian Affiliate also owns a 500-seat performance venue.

Loose Park

Loose Park in Kansas City is the perfect place to get out and enjoy the great outdoors. The 3.1 mile trail has an elevation gain in excess of 187 feet. It is rated easy. The trail and park are heavily used by tourists. Park officials recommend that playground equipment not be used during peak hours.

The park covers 75 acres and can be found near the Plaza. It includes a playground and walking paths as well as tennis courts, rose gardens, and Civil War markers. There's also a Japanese tea house and a picnic area. Visitors can also enjoy watching brave squirrels as they explore the park.

There is also a rose-garden in the park that houses the municipal rose gardens. It was established in 1931 by Laura Conyers Smith and now has more than 3,000 roses in 130 varieties. A $400,000 renovation of the rose beds restored them to their original layout, and 1,200 additional roses were added.

The garden center is located south of the large lake. You can find park information in the center's metal box. Two large meeting rooms are available at the garden center, each with attached small kitchens. You can also visit the park's horticultural librarian, which is open Monday-Friday.

Loose parks also has a pond that is popular for photograph opportunities. The pond is usually home to ducks. It covers 75 acres, or the equivalent of 57 football pitches. It is the third largest park within the city. This makes it an ideal spot for any outdoor activity.

SEA LIFE Kansas City.

Sea Life Kansas City can be found in Kansas City Missouri. This interactive aquarium houses thousands of aquatic creatures. The aquarium boasts a 360° ocean tunnel and touch-pools. Merlin Entertainments owns the attraction. Sea Life Kansas City is the perfect place to spend a family day.

Crown Center's Aquarium offers interactive talks during the day. Parking is available on-site and admission is free. Parking is available at the Crown Center Parking Garage next to the aquarium. You can also get parking tickets validated at this facility. There are many restaurants in the Crown Center District, so it is easy to find something to eat and drink after visiting an aquarium.

The SEA LIFE Kansas City Aquarium houses thousands of tropical fish in over 30 exhibits. You can also view sharks, starfish, and rays. You can also create your own virtual sea creature and print it.

SEA LIFE Kansas City provides a fun and educational aquarium experience for families. The aquarium houses 5,000 animals, which include many species of fish and other living creatures. SEA LIFE features a Merlin's Apprentice Ride Adventure, a LEGO 4D Theater and a Master Builders Exhibit.
